•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/freebsd-13-stable/usr.sbin/nscd/

Lines Matching refs:cache_queue_policy_

74 static void destroy_cache_queue_policy(struct cache_queue_policy_ *);
75 static struct cache_queue_policy_ *init_cache_queue_policy(void);
81 * cache_queue_policy_ with cache_update_item function changed.
111 struct cache_queue_policy_ *queue_policy;
115 queue_policy = (struct cache_queue_policy_ *)policy;
125 struct cache_queue_policy_ *queue_policy;
129 queue_policy = (struct cache_queue_policy_ *)policy;
138 struct cache_queue_policy_ *queue_policy;
141 queue_policy = (struct cache_queue_policy_ *)policy;
149 struct cache_queue_policy_ *queue_policy;
152 queue_policy = (struct cache_queue_policy_ *)policy;
162 struct cache_queue_policy_ *queue_policy;
166 queue_policy = (struct cache_queue_policy_ *)policy;
177 struct cache_queue_policy_ *queue_policy;
181 queue_policy = (struct cache_queue_policy_ *)policy;
190 * Initializes cache_queue_policy_ by filling the structure with the functions
193 static struct cache_queue_policy_ *
196 struct cache_queue_policy_ *retval;
224 destroy_cache_queue_policy(struct cache_queue_policy_ *queue_policy)
240 * Makes cache_queue_policy_ behave like FIFO policy - we don't do anything,
257 struct cache_queue_policy_ *retval;
270 struct cache_queue_policy_ *queue_policy;
273 queue_policy = (struct cache_queue_policy_ *)policy;
279 * Makes cache_queue_policy_ behave like LRU policy. On each update, cache
287 struct cache_queue_policy_ *queue_policy;
291 queue_policy = (struct cache_queue_policy_ *)policy;
302 struct cache_queue_policy_ *retval;
315 struct cache_queue_policy_ *queue_policy;
318 queue_policy = (struct cache_queue_policy_ *)policy;
325 * LRU and FIFO (both based on cache_queue_policy_). Almost all cache_policy_